1import torch
2from transformers import AutoModelForCausalLM, AutoTokenizer
3
4model_id = "AhıskaAI/AhıskaAI-110M-Experimental-v0.1"
5
6tokenizer = AutoTokenizer.from_pretrained(model_id)
7model = AutoModelForCausalLM.from_pretrained(
8 model_id,
9 torch_dtype=torch.float16 if torch.cuda.is_available() else torch.float32,
10 device_map="auto"
11)
12
13prompt = "Bir zamanlar uzak bir ülkede"
14inputs = tokenizer(prompt, return_tensors="pt").to(model.device)
15
16outputs = model.generate(
17 **inputs,
18 max_new_tokens=100,
19 temperature=0.7,
20 top_p=0.9,
21 do_sample=True
22)
23
24print(tokenizer.decode(outputs[0], skip_special_tokens=True))
